Lethargy
English and Urdu gloss, synonyms and antonyms, and example usage from our editorial sentence cache where available.
English meaning
a lack of energy and enthusiasm.
Urdu meaning
غنودگی، طویل نیند، کمزوری

Synonyms
sluggishness, inertia, inactivity, inaction, slowness, torpor, torpidity, lifelessness,
Antonyms
vigour, energy, animation
Curator example
“there was an air of lethargy about him”
